The National Engineering Research Center for Safety and Operation and Maintenance of Urban Railway Systems is established and operated by Guangzhou Metro Group Co., Ltd. The center focuses on serving national and industry strategic needs, adhering to the principles of "openness, cooperation, and sharing," and tackles key technologies related to urban rail transit system safety, intelligent operation and maintenance, vibration and noise reduction, and green low-carbon solutions.
The center is the only national engineering research center in the rail transit industry based on a metro construction and operation unit. It is rooted in the Guangdong-Hong Kong-Macao Greater Bay Area and serves the national strategy of "Rail Transit in the Greater Bay Area." The center focuses on innovation research and real-world validation environments for the full lifecycle of metro, suburban, intercity rail, and tram systems. It supports the integrated and collaborative development of rail transit planning and design, engineering construction, operation services, and equipment manufacturing, serving national strategies such as "Transportation Powerhouse," "Manufacturing Powerhouse," and the "Belt and Road Initiative." In early 2024, the "National Engineering Research Center for Urban Rail Transit System Safety and Operation & Maintenance Assurance," led by Guangzhou Metro Group, was awarded the first "National Outstanding Engineer Team" recognition by the Central Committee of the Communist Party of China and the State Council.
The center adopts a "1+7+N" construction and operation model, operating under a director responsible system led by a council. It is led by Guangzhou Metro Group Co., Ltd., in collaboration with seven co-builders, including Beijing Jiaotong University, Central South University, Guangzhou Metro Design & Research Institute Co., Ltd., and CRRC Zhuzhou Times Electric Co., Ltd., along with numerous other partners. Guangzhou Metro Design & Research Institute Co., Ltd., as a co-builder, is responsible for the promotion and application of scientific and technological achievements, the collection of urban rail transit science and technology information domestically and internationally, and assisting in organizing government science and technology projects, as well as applying for science and technology awards from government/associations/societies. The institute oversees research platforms for traction network service safety assurance technology, power supply system safety detection technology, urban rail transit energy-saving technology, and automatic escalator and elevator safety monitoring and operation & maintenance technology, and participates in the research and construction of other related platforms.
